eng In-gel detection of phosphoproteins by selective staining: possibilities and comparison Protein phosphorylation represents one of the most studied post-translational modifications, which in particular plays a significant role in a wide range of cellular processes. In this work we focused on selective detection of phosphoproteins directly in 1-D or 2-D electrophoretic gels using different staining techniques. We compared commercially available fluorescent detection by Pro-Q Diamond (Invitrogen) and Phos-tag Phosphoprotein Gel Stain (PerkinElmer) and non-fluorescent GelCode Gel Stain (Pierce). Mentioned dyes were utilized for selective detection of phosphoproteins in model protein mixtures, cell lysates of Francisella tularensis or in dephosporylation studies. Parameters such selectivity, sensitivity, required instrumentation, time-consumption or compatibility with MALDI-TOF-MS were evaluated. In-gel detection; phosphoproteins; selective staining
